Why Are More People Choosing Family-Run Estate Agents?

While national chains often have large marketing budgets and multiple branches, local independent agencies offer several advantages.


Personal Service

With a family-run agency, you're more likely to deal with the same people throughout your property journey.

Whether you're selling a home, letting an investment property or searching for a tenant, consistent communication can make the process far less stressful.


MoveZone's family-led team has built its reputation on personal service, transparency and long-term client relationships.

Better Local Market Knowledge


Property values can vary significantly across Bromley, Bickley, Chislehurst, Hayes, Beckenham and surrounding areas.

Local agencies often have deeper knowledge of:


  • Current buyer demand
  • Rental values
  • School catchment areas
  • Commuter hotspots
  • Emerging market trends


This local insight helps sellers price correctly and landlords maximise rental returns.


Faster Decision Making

Unlike national agencies that may rely on regional management structures, family-run businesses can often make decisions quickly and respond to clients more effectively.


This can be particularly valuable when dealing with:


  • Tenant issues
  • Property maintenance
  • Sales negotiations
  • Urgent valuations

Landlords often ask:


"Can a family-run agency manage my rental property effectively?"

The answer is yes.

A professional property management service should include:


  • Tenant sourcing
  • Referencing
  • Rent collection
  • Property inspections
  • Maintenance coordination
  • Compliance management
  • Tenant communication

What Makes a Good Residential Property Expert?

Whether you're buying, selling or letting, a quality estate agent should offer:

Accurate Property Valuations

Local market knowledge ensures realistic pricing and better results.

Strong Marketing

Professional photography, property portals and targeted promotion help attract buyers and tenants.

Communication

One of the biggest frustrations in property transactions is poor communication. A good agent provides regular updates and clear advice.

Local Expertise

Knowledge of Bromley's schools, transport links, amenities and neighbourhoods helps buyers and tenants make informed decisions.


Frequently Asked Questions


Who are the best estate agents in Bromley?

The best estate agent depends on your priorities. Some homeowners prefer large national brands, while others value the personalised approach offered by family-run local agencies with deep community roots.


Is a family-run estate agent better for landlords?

Many landlords find family-run agencies provide more responsive service and better communication, particularly when managing maintenance issues and tenant relationships.


How much does property management cost?

Fees vary depending on the level of service required. Most landlords should compare management packages based on service quality and value rather than selecting solely on price.


Why is local knowledge important when selling a property?

Local knowledge helps agents understand buyer demand, pricing trends and the features that make particular areas attractive, resulting in more accurate valuations and stronger marketing strategies.
